Browserbase runs real browsers that pull KYC data from business registries, sanctions lists, license boards, and government portals. Faster onboarding, fewer escalations, full audit trails.

Pull registration status, NAICS codes, officers, and addresses from secretary of state and corporate registries.
Run names against OFAC, EU, UK, and UN sanctions lists and capture matches with full evidence.
Verify professional licenses, broker registrations, and credentials across state boards.
Yes. Browserbase is SOC 2 Type II certified and HIPAA compliant, with each browser running in a dedicated VM for strict isolation. You can disable session logging and recording to support zero data retention, and self-hosted deployment is available for teams with strict compliance requirements.
Any web-based portal. Teams use Browserbase for business registries, secretary of state filings, sanctions and watchlist databases, professional license boards, beneficial ownership registers, and adverse media sources. If an analyst can open it in a browser, you can automate it.
Browserbase includes built-in stealth with fingerprint management, residential proxies, and automatic captcha solving. Combined with human-like navigation via Stagehand, your automation can access government and registry sites that block off-the-shelf headless tooling.

Collect UBO filings, politically exposed person records, and adverse media from public sources.
Yes. Every session can record video, full network traffic, and DOM snapshots. Pair that with structured JSON output and screenshots for each step, and your team has a defensible audit trail for every decision.
Managed KYC vendors are useful when their data sources cover your jurisdictions and risk model. Browserbase fills the gaps: jurisdictions, registries, and license boards that vendors do not support, plus the ability to combine multiple sources into your own scoring logic.
Yes. Browserbase scales to hundreds of concurrent browser sessions out of the box, so you can verify large applicant batches without redesigning your workflow.
